In recent days, Google DeepMind unveiled Alpha Evolve, a Gemini-powered coding agent that is pioneering algorithmic discovery. This revolutionary technology symbolizes a significant advancement in artificial intelligence, with the potential to redefine how we approach AI development. Let’s delve into the core insights regarding Alpha Evolve and its implications for the future of technology.
🚀 The AI Evolution Revolution
A New Era of Algorithmic Discovery
Alpha Evolve signifies a shift from traditional coding practices to an AI-driven approach to developing algorithms. This innovation allows the system to autonomously improve code through a feedback loop, creating a self-optimizing cycle. The key components of this feedback loop include:
- Program Database: Stores code versions and performance metrics.
- Prompt Sampler: Selects previous code snippets to formulate new prompts.
- Language Model (LM): Evaluates prompts and generates improved code versions.
- Evaluators Pool: Tests the new code, measuring improvements in speed and efficiency.
This seamless interaction results in progressively optimized code with minimal human intervention. Interestingly, this approach not only enhances AI performance but also revolutionizes how algorithms are discovered and modified.
Surprising Fact: The continuous testing and iteration employed by Alpha Evolve can lead to improvements that human developers might miss due to variability in coding practices.
💡 Practical Tip: Embrace Feedback Loops
Adopt a mindset of continuous improvement in your coding practices by regularly seeking feedback on your work. Simply asking peers to review your code can yield remarkable results.
⚡ Efficiency in Action
Real-World Applications
Alpha Evolve has already showcased its prowess in optimizing various facets of Google’s operations:
-
Data Center Optimization: By addressing the Borg scheduling problem, Alpha Evolve improved job scheduling, recovering 0.7% of compute resources across Google’s server farms.
-
TPU Circuit Design: It streamlined the design of AI training hardware, leading to reduced power consumption and enhanced performance in critical components.
-
Software Efficiency: Alpha Evolve optimized training processes for Google Gemini, achieving a 23% speedup on crucial computational kernels.
These enhancements illustrate how an intelligent system can directly impact efficiency across vast technological landscapes.
Quote to Remember: “Efficient AI can improve itself, leading to exponential growth in capabilities and productivity.” This insight underscores the transformative potential of Alpha Evolve.
🔧 Practical Tip: Analyze Your Workflows
Regularly audit your own processes and identify areas for optimization. Applying similar principles of efficiency from Alpha Evolve could yield significant productivity gains.
📊 Breakthroughs in Matrix Multiplication
A Significant Algorithmic Achievement
One of the most groundbreaking feats of Alpha Evolve involves efficiently solving complex matrix multiplication challenges. Historically dominated by Strassen’s 1969 method, which required eight multiplications to multiply 2×2 matrices, Alpha Evolve innovated a new approach utilizing just 48 multiplications for 4×4 matrices. This achievement marks the first time since 1969 that a significant breakthrough in matrix multiplication has occurred.
Why is this important? Matrix multiplication is fundamental in numerous fields such as machine learning, computer graphics, and operations research. Enhancing this operation can lead to improved AI training times and operational efficiency.
Fun Fact: The typical scale of operation for modern AI models involves billions of matrix multiplications, making even slight improvements immensely impactful.
🔗 Practical Tip: Explore Mathematical Optimization
Those interested in programming or AI should familiarize themselves with mathematical optimization techniques, as they could significantly enhance algorithmic performance. Websites like Khan Academy provide excellent resources.
🔄 The Cycle of Self-Improvement
The Future of AI Development
The recursive nature of Alpha Evolve suggests that efficient AI could create even more efficient AI systems. This concept of self-improvement hinges on the system’s ability to close the feedback loop — continuously refining and enhancing its own algorithms, which could benefit future AI developments.
Predictions hint that in a few years, we may witness AI agents capable of conducting independent AI research, drastically accelerating the pace of innovation and breakthroughs in technology.
Provocative Thought: Imagine a future where AI-enhanced tools contribute significantly to independent research efforts, pushing human-led discoveries to new horizons.
🧠 Practical Tip: Foster Collaboration with Technology
Utilize existing AI tools to enhance your own projects. Engage in platforms where AI can assist in performing mundane or complex tasks, freeing up time for more creative or strategic endeavors.
🌟 The Path Ahead in AI Research
Toward a New Frontier
Experts predict that within the next few years, we may witness AI systems capable of accomplishing tasks currently reserved for human researchers. The sprint towards automation in AI research hinges on the establishment of efficient feedback loops like those fostered by Alpha Evolve.
This trajectory indicates a potential for radical shifts in our understanding of artificial intelligence and its applications in solving complex problems — perhaps even leading to superintelligent systems by the end of this decade.
Quote to Ponder: “Once we have the self-improving feedback loop, we can compress decades of knowledge into mere months.” This succinctly encapsulates the urgency and impact of Alpha Evolve’s innovations.
🛠️ Practical Tip: Stay Informed
Keep abreast of advancements in AI research and tools. Websites like arXiv provide free access to the latest findings in AI and machine learning.
🎒 Resource Toolbox
- Alpha Evolve Blog: In-depth exploration of Alpha Evolve and its capabilities.
- AI Academy: Join to learn more about AI development.
- The AI Grid on Twitter: Follow for updates and insights in AI.
- The AI Grid Website: Access resources and tools on AI innovations.
- Khan Academy: Great educational resource for mathematics and optimization strategies.
- arXiv: Archive for cutting-edge research papers in AI and machine learning.
As we pave the way for advancements like Alpha Evolve, it’s essential to embrace a future where technology continually enhances our systems, behaviors, and discoveries. Together, we can harness this potential and shape a brighter tomorrow.